As a web designer in the Philippines, creating high-performance websites is essential to help businesses attract and retain visitors. A slow or poorly optimized website can frustrate users and drive away potential customers. Advanced HTML techniques are a great way to build fast, efficient websites that offer a seamless user experience. In this guide, we’ll explore several techniques to enhance website performance using HTML best practices.
Why Website Performance Matters for Businesses in the Philippines
For businesses targeting local and global markets, a fast website can improve visitor satisfaction, reduce bounce rates, and rank higher on search engines. Many Filipino customers use mobile devices, and they expect pages to load quickly despite internet limitations in certain areas. As a web designer in the Philippines, applying advanced HTML techniques will give your clients a competitive advantage by improving website speed, accessibility, and user experience.
Key HTML Techniques for High-Performance Websites
1. Use HTML5 Semantic Tags for Cleaner Code
HTML5 offers semantic tags like <article>
, <section>
, and <nav>
that make code more readable for browsers and search engines. Clean code improves performance by making the structure easier to render and index.
Example:
htmlCopy code<article>
<h2>About Us</h2>
<p>Our company offers eco-friendly packaging solutions across the Philippines.</p>
</article>
Using semantic tags also boosts SEO, helping businesses rank higher on search engine results.
2. Lazy Loading for Faster Page Loads
Lazy loading ensures that images and videos load only when they come into view, saving bandwidth and improving page speed. For websites with lots of media, this technique is a game-changer.
Example:
htmlCopy code<img src="product.jpg" loading="lazy" alt="Product Image">
This small change ensures images do not slow down the initial page load, creating a smoother user experience for visitors.
3. Minimize HTTP Requests Using Inline SVGs
Icons and small graphics are often better served as SVGs (Scalable Vector Graphics). Inline SVGs reduce HTTP requests, which speeds up the website.
Example:
htmlCopy code<svg width="100" height="100">
<circle cx="50" cy="50" r="40" stroke="green" stroke-width="4" fill="yellow" />
</svg>
This technique ensures faster loading times without sacrificing visual quality.
4. Preload Key Resources
Preloading critical resources like fonts ensures that they are ready to render as soon as the page loads, reducing delay and improving perceived performance.
Example:
htmlCopy code<link rel="preload" href="fonts/customfont.woff2" as="font" type="font/woff2" crossorigin="anonymous">
This is especially useful for websites with custom fonts that need to display correctly right away.
5. Use HTML Compression with Gzip or Brotli
Compressed HTML files load faster because they contain fewer bytes. Enable Gzip or Brotli compression on your server to minimize file sizes without compromising content quality. Most hosting providers offer these compression options.
6. Prioritize Above-the-Fold Content
Above-the-fold content refers to the part of the page visible without scrolling. Load this content first to improve user engagement. Use this technique in combination with CSS for optimized results.
Example:
htmlCopy code<style>
.hero-banner {
height: 100vh;
background: url('banner.jpg') no-repeat center center;
}
</style>
<div class="hero-banner">
<h1>Welcome to Our Website</h1>
</div>
Loading the most important content first makes your site feel faster and keeps users engaged.
7. Reduce Inline CSS and JavaScript Blocking
Avoid embedding too much CSS or JavaScript directly in HTML, as it can delay page rendering. Instead, link external CSS and JS files and use the defer
attribute for JavaScript.
Example:
htmlCopy code<script src="script.js" defer></script>
Using defer
ensures the JavaScript file runs only after the HTML is fully loaded, speeding up the initial load.
Practical Tips for Web Designers in the Philippines
- Optimize Images for Mobile Devices
- Use responsive images with the
<picture>
tag to load different image sizes for different devices.
<picture> <source media="(max-width: 600px)" srcset="small.jpg"> <img src="large.jpg" alt="Responsive Image"> </picture>
- Use responsive images with the
- Audit Website Performance Regularly
- Use tools like Google Lighthouse or GTmetrix to identify performance bottlenecks and optimize the site accordingly.
- Implement Caching Strategies
- Use browser caching to store frequently accessed resources locally, reducing server load and speeding up the site for returning visitors.
- Test Websites Across Devices and Connections
- Test your websites on different devices (desktop, mobile, tablet) and internet speeds to ensure a consistent experience, especially in regions with slower networks.
Impact of High-Performance Websites on Businesses in the Philippines
Businesses in the Philippines increasingly rely on their online presence to reach customers and drive sales. A high-performance website:
- Provides a better user experience and keeps visitors engaged.
- Improves search engine rankings, bringing more organic traffic.
- Increases conversions and helps businesses achieve their goals.
As a web designer in the Philippines, delivering fast, efficient websites will boost your reputation and attract more clients from industries like e-commerce, tourism, and professional services.
Final Thoughts
By mastering these advanced HTML techniques, you can build high-performance websites that meet the growing demands of businesses in the Philippines. Fast-loading, user-friendly sites not only enhance customer satisfaction but also improve SEO rankings, giving your clients an edge over competitors.
Incorporating strategies like lazy loading, semantic HTML, and resource optimization ensures that your websites deliver both speed and functionality. These techniques will position you as a trusted web designer in the Philippines, capable of creating modern, high-performance websites that drive business success.